Definition

'Contents' means all the things inside something, like a box or a book. It usually refers to the items or information held within something.

Usage & Nuances

Always plural: 'contents' (not 'content') when referring to objects/things inside something. Common phrases: 'table of contents' (list in a book), 'box contents'. Do not confuse with 'content' (singular), which can mean subject or substance.
